To truly understand Masifa Rounded, one must first look at its creator and his foundry. The font was designed by Oğuzhan Cengiz, an accomplished Istanbul-based art director and type designer. Cengiz established in early 2018 with a clear mission: to produce innovative and "timeless" fonts. This boutique foundry quickly made a name for itself in the industry. Its first release, the Milas family, was exhibited at MyFonts and ranked 12th on its "Hot New Fonts" list, later earning the prestigious Best Font Design Award from the Graphic Designers Association (GMK) in its 36th Graphic Design Exhibition.
